Islamabad: The Asian Development Bank (ADB) has approved a loan of 250 million dollars for Pakistan.
According to the statement issued, the money will be used to improve the power transmission system in Punjab and Khyber Pakhtunkhwa and the high voltage transmission network will be expanded.
ADB stated that the project will help increase transmission capacity, reduce transmission losses in Punjab as reliable power supply is essential for inclusive and sustainable economic growth.
